SECONDARY SCHOOL CENTER OFFICIALLY OPENED

LAKTAŠI, AUGUST 29 /SRNA/ – The President of Republika Srpska Milorad Dodik and the Mayor of Laktaši Miroslav Bojić today ceremonially opened the Secondary School Center in this local community.

The official ribbon-cutting ceremony was also attended by the Minister of Education and Culture of Republika Srpska Željka Stojičić as well as the director of the Secondary School Center, Danijela Stanišljević-Ivanović. The ceremony marking the opening of the Secondary School Center, for the construction of which BAM 10.5 million were invested, was also attended by the Minister of Finance and Treasury in the Council of Ministers Srđan Amidžić, mayors and heads of other local communities, and numerous citizens. Mayor of Laktaši Miroslav Bojić told SRNA that BAM 10.5 million had been invested in the construction of the facility, of which BAM six million were provided by the Government of Republika Srpska, and the remainder by the local community. The director of the institution earlier told SRNA that 190 students were enrolled in the first enrollment cycle. "Great interest in all offered programs showed that the school was already at the very beginning recognized as a desirable place for education," Ivanović said. She noted that the number of enrolled students is in line with the planned number and structure of enrollment places, therefore achieving the basic goal of securing a stable foundation for the work and development of the school already with the first generation. "Students are distributed into four fields – health care, electrical engineering, mechanical engineering, and economics – which provides diversity and alignment of the educational offer with contemporary needs. Such a structured enrollment plan has proven to be a well-balanced and justified decision, since we managed to attract the expected number of students and at the same time ensure even distribution across all classes," Ivanović explained.
